Gateshead sales fetches $2.75 million
A property at 135 Bulls Garden Road, Gateshead which was partly occupied by Fox Mining has been sold by Byrne Tran and Jayson Robertson from Colliers International on behalf of Receivers and Managers, Grant Thornton.
The property sold for $2.75 million following an Expressions of Interest campaign. The eventual purchaser was a local investor who plans to refurbish the existing improvements totalling around 5,389 sqm.
The property is now being offered for lease through Colliers International and various size office, warehouse and workshop accommodation next to TLE Electrical.

Beresfield industrial land sold
A lot of approximately 1500 sqm has been sold in the Freeway North Business Park at Beresfield.
The land is conveniently located at the end of the M1, providing easy access to Sydney and highway linkage to Newcastle. It is also in proximity to the Hunter Expressway, offering easy access to Cessnock and the Upper Hunter.
Paul Tilden from Raine & Horne Commercial negotiated the deal.

Hunter Freeway access attracts buyer to Kurri Kurri
Tony Cant Commercial recently sold a major warehouse in Kurri Kurri at auction for $2,450,000. This property was purchased to allow the owner/occupier to manage a Terex distributorship close to a major transport hub. The Hunter Expressway is only 3 minutes away
The property included:
• Clear Span warehouse area
• ample office space / training rooms / amenities
• 7 metre eave height
• roller doors at each end of the building
• excellent truck access
• loading bay
• airconditioned offices and warehouse area
• fully fenced and secure site
• plenty of parking for the staff
The property had a land area of 2.42 ha with a building area of 6,141 sqm.

Mayfield industrial unit sold
A small industrial unit has been sold at Unit 11, 56 Industrial Drive, Mayfield for $222,500 + GST.
Only minutes from the Newcastle CBD and the Port, it includes ground first floor offices with air-conditioning, small rear yard, rear roller door access to warehouse and easy vehicular access into the complex. The warehouse area is approximately 132 sqm.
The sale was though Paul Tilden at Raine & Horne Commercial Newcastle.
